Banglorecity raised highest fund.
Most of Startups were fromBanglorecity (285).
Consumer Internet based Startups have the
highest Investors andFunding.
Most of the Fundraising were raised by Seed
Funding(56%) and Private Equity(44%)
There were total 993 Startups in 2016 and
443 Startups in 2017 which raised goodFunds.
Flipkart and Paytm companies raised the highest
funding of $1,40,00,00,000
Total Investment in
Startups
2016:
$3,82,80,88,608
2017:$5,84,62,75,500
